The tour kicks off in the charming heart of Sintra, a town that seems to have stepped straight out of a storybook. We love how the guide takes you through the narrow cobbled streets, immediately setting a tone of enchantment. The first stop is the center of the village, where you’ll get a quick glance at the vibrant streets and quaint shops—an ideal introduction without rushing.
Next, there’s the Sintra National Palace — for those who choose to visit, this palace offers a glimpse into Portugal’s medieval past with its distinctive twin chimneys and ornate rooms. Although the admission fee isn’t included, many travelers appreciate having the option to explore inside at their own pace. One reviewer mentioned that the area is rich in history, and the palace’s architecture is stunning, making it worth the extra expense if history intrigues you.
The highlight for many is the Quinta da Regaleira, a UNESCO-listed site that feels like stepping into a secret garden filled with mystical tunnels, lush greenery, and symbolic architecture. We loved the way this site combines natural beauty with enigmatic symbolism—perfect for wandering and snapping photos. The guide often makes a point of noting the UNESCO classification, emphasizing how this site fits into the broader cultural landscape of Sintra.
For those with a taste for luxury, passing through Seteais, a 18th-century palace turned hotel, offers a peek into Sintra’s aristocratic past. Its impressive façade and manicured gardens create a sense of timeless elegance, and the drive-by view is a treat.
The Parque e Palácio de Monserrate is another highlight, with its exotic gardens and a palace that blends Gothic, Indian, and Moorish influences. One review pointed out that the palace overlooks the Atlantic, adding a dramatic backdrop that enhances the visit. The entrance fee isn’t included, so plan accordingly if you wish to explore inside.

Leaving Sintra behind, the tour takes us through Estoril, famous for its elegant casino and seaside resorts. Passing by this area gives travelers a sense of the luxurious lifestyle that has long characterized Cascais, once a hideaway for European aristocracy. Many visitors comment on Cascais’ glamorous vibe, with lavish mansions and a lively marina.
If you’re interested, the tour includes a quick stop in the center of Cascais, where you can stroll along the lively streets, browse boutique shops, or grab a coffee. It’s a great opportunity to soak up the local atmosphere and perhaps indulge in some fresh seafood.
One of the most striking sights is Boca do Inferno, a natural chasm carved into the cliffs by the Atlantic waves. Visitors find the views here absolutely spectacular, and the free entrance means you can enjoy the dramatic coastline without extra costs. As one review mentions, the breathtaking views and the sound of crashing waves make this spot unforgettable.
Continuing along the coast, the tour reaches Cabo da Roca, the most westerly point in Europe. The rugged cliffs, expansive ocean views, and brisk sea breeze create a sense of being at the edge of the continent. Many travelers enjoy the photo opportunities here and find the visit a highlight of the day.
